Understanding the Landscape: What Makes a Good Chat AI?
Before diving into specific products, it’s crucial to understand the underlying principles of a good chat AI. It’s more than just natural language processing; it’s about creating a seamless and valuable user experience. A high-quality chat AI possesses several key attributes.
- Natural Language Understanding (NLU): Accurately interpreting user intent, even with variations in phrasing, slang, or grammatical errors, is paramount. A chat AI that frequently misunderstands simple requests quickly becomes frustrating.
- Natural Language Generation (NLG): Crafting responses that are not only accurate but also human-sounding and engaging. The goal is to avoid robotic or generic replies that detract from the user experience.
- Contextual Awareness: Remembering previous interactions and using that information to personalize future responses. This creates a more cohesive and efficient conversation flow.
- Personalization: Adapting to individual user preferences and needs. This could involve tailoring recommendations, adjusting response tone, or remembering specific details about the user.
- Accuracy and Reliability: Providing correct information and avoiding factual errors. The model should be trained on a comprehensive and up-to-date knowledge base.
- Scalability: Handling a large volume of requests without sacrificing performance. This is especially important for businesses with high customer interaction rates.
- Integration Capabilities: Seamlessly integrating with existing business systems, such as CRM platforms, e-commerce platforms, and help desk software.
- Security and Privacy: Protecting user data and complying with relevant privacy regulations.
- Customization: Allowing businesses to tailor the chat AI to their specific branding, tone, and use cases.
- Continuous Learning: Adapting and improving its performance over time through machine learning.
These features collectively determine the overall effectiveness of a chat AI. A well-rounded solution excels in each of these areas, providing a powerful tool for businesses looking to enhance their customer experience and streamline their operations. Evaluating GPT Chat: Key Features and Performance Metrics
When reviewing a GPT chat solution, it’s essential to go beyond the marketing materials and delve into the specifics. Here’s a breakdown of key features and performance metrics to consider:
Features to Examine:
- Pre-trained Models: Evaluate the quality and scope of the pre-trained models offered. Are they general-purpose or tailored to specific industries? How frequently are they updated?
- Customization Options: Explore the options for fine-tuning the model with your own data. This is crucial for tailoring the chat AI to your specific business needs and brand voice.
- API Integration: Assess the ease of integration with your existing systems. Does the provider offer comprehensive API documentation and support?
- Analytics and Reporting: Determine the level of analytics and reporting provided. Can you track key metrics such as user satisfaction, conversation length, and resolution rate?
- Security Measures: Investigate the security measures in place to protect user data. Is the platform compliant with relevant security standards and regulations?
- Pricing Model: Understand the pricing structure and how it scales with usage. Are there any hidden fees or limitations?
Performance Metrics to Track:
- Accuracy: Measure the percentage of user queries that are correctly understood and answered.
- Completion Rate: Track the percentage of conversations that result in a successful resolution.
- Conversation Length: Monitor the average number of turns required to resolve a user query. Shorter conversations typically indicate greater efficiency.
- User Satisfaction: Gather feedback from users to assess their overall experience with the chat AI. This can be done through surveys, ratings, or direct feedback mechanisms.
- Containment Rate: Measure the percentage of user queries that are resolved entirely by the chat AI, without requiring human intervention. This indicates the effectiveness of the automation.
- Response Time: Measure the average time it takes for the chat AI to respond to a user query. Faster response times contribute to a better user experience.
Careful evaluation of these features and performance metrics will help you determine which GPT chat solution is the best fit for your specific business requirements. Navigating the Challenges: Limitations and Ethical Considerations
While GPT chat offers tremendous potential, it’s important to acknowledge its limitations and address the ethical considerations associated with its use.
- Accuracy and Bias: GPT models are trained on massive datasets, which may contain biases that can be reflected in their responses. This can lead to inaccurate or discriminatory outcomes.
- Hallucinations: GPT models can sometimes generate incorrect or nonsensical information, a phenomenon known as "hallucinations." This is a particular concern when using chat AI for critical applications.
- Security Risks: Chatbots can be vulnerable to hacking and other security threats. It’s important to implement robust security measures to protect user data and prevent unauthorized access.
- Privacy Concerns: Chatbots collect user data, which raises privacy concerns. Businesses must be transparent about how they collect and use this data and comply with relevant privacy regulations.
- Job Displacement: The automation potential of chat AI raises concerns about job displacement. Businesses should consider the impact on their workforce and implement strategies to mitigate any negative consequences.
- Transparency and Explainability: Understanding how a chat AI arrives at a particular response can be challenging. This lack of transparency can make it difficult to identify and correct errors.
Addressing these challenges requires a proactive approach. Businesses should carefully evaluate the accuracy and bias of GPT models, implement robust security measures, and be transparent about their data privacy practices. They should also invest in training and support to help employees adapt to the changing landscape and mitigate the risk of job displacement.

FAQ: Answering Your Burning Questions About GPT Chat
Q1: How secure is GPT chat for handling sensitive customer data?
Security is paramount when handling sensitive customer data. GPT chat solutions typically employ various security measures, including encryption, access controls, and regular security audits. However, the level of security can vary depending on the provider. It’s crucial to thoroughly investigate the security practices of any GPT chat solution you’re considering. This includes understanding how data is stored, processed, and protected, as well as the provider’s compliance with relevant security standards and regulations like GDPR or HIPAA. A strong security posture should include data anonymization techniques and role-based access control, ensuring only authorized personnel can access sensitive information. Furthermore, it’s important to have a clear understanding of the data retention policies to ensure that data is not stored longer than necessary.
Q2: Can GPT chat really replace human customer service agents?
While GPT chat can automate many customer service tasks and provide 24/7 support, it’s unlikely to completely replace human agents. Chatbots are best suited for handling routine inquiries and resolving basic issues. More complex or emotionally charged situations often require human intervention. The ideal approach is to use GPT chat to augment human agents, freeing them up to focus on more challenging and rewarding tasks. This hybrid model allows businesses to provide efficient and cost-effective customer service while still maintaining a human touch. For instance, a chatbot could handle initial inquiries, gather information, and then seamlessly transfer the conversation to a human agent if necessary.

Q6: How do I measure the success of my GPT chat implementation?
Measuring the success of your GPT chat implementation requires tracking key performance indicators (KPIs) such as accuracy, completion rate, conversation length, user satisfaction, and containment rate. These metrics provide valuable insights into the effectiveness of the chatbot and its impact on your business. Regularly monitor these KPIs and use the data to identify areas for improvement. A/B testing different chatbot configurations can help optimize performance and improve user experience. Collect user feedback through surveys and ratings to gain a deeper understanding of their perceptions and needs.
